Trust by design

Local-first by default.

MacFlow is designed so its core daily-driver data stays on your Mac. Network features are explicit, integrations are permission-gated, update downloads are SHA-256 verified, and this public beta is Apple-notarized and Developer ID signed.

Public beta notes

Production-signed, still improving.

This build is intended for early public use. Apple Silicon is the first supported architecture; Intel is deferred. Core MacFlow use remains local-first, and update checks remain explicit rather than background-driven.
